All Washington State residents who, between October 8, 2007 and November 30, 2011, received a telephone call from or on behalf of Best Buy regarding Best Buy’s “Certificate Reminder” or “Go Digital” campaigns that had been placed using an automated dialer and an artificial or pre-recorded voice. 2 3 4 5 National Class. All United States residents except for those residing in Washington state who, between October 8, 2007 and November 30, 2011, received a telephone call from or on behalf of Best Buy regarding Best Buy’s “Go Digital” campaign, after they had requested not to be called. 6 7 8 9 3. This Court approves and directs payments as follows: a. Distribution of $3,212,500 to eligible Settlement Class Members as set forth in the Settlement Agreement, Section III.F-G; 27 [PROPOSED] FINAL JUDGMENT AND ORDER OF DISMISSAL - 3 CASE NO. 2:10-CV-00774-RAJ TERRELL MARSHALL DAUDT & WILLIE PLLC 936 North 34th Street, Suite 300 Seattle, Washington 98103-8869 TEL. 206.816.6603 • FAX 206.350.3528 www.tmdwlaw.com 1 2 b. An incentive award of $5,000 to the name Plaintiff, Michael Chesbro; c. $1,137,500 to Class Counsel for their attorneys’ fees and out-of-pocket and 3 4 costs. This Court finds these amounts are justified when considered as a percentage of the 5 common fund Class Counsel created, particularly in light of the results obtained for Settlement 6 Class Members. This Court finds that the total cost of giving notice and claims administration, 7 $195,000, are reasonable and properly paid to the Claims Administrator.
